Full Job Description
What you'll do

As a Manager, Sales Development, you will build, lead and mentor a high performing Sales Development team who are responsible for outbound prospecting and pipeline generation. Strong candidates will be data-driven and focused on improving and optimizing individual and team results. Success in the role requires excellent interpersonal and communication skills, cross-functional alignment and a focus on innovation and testing. You will be working directly with Sales leaders, marketing, and executives to help evolve this key motion of the business.

Responsibilities
  • Lead and mentor an SDR team to achieve monthly and quarterly quota
  • Recruit, hire, onboard and ramp SDRs effectively to drive early success in role
  • Provide regular coaching, feedback and professional development while prioritizing and maintaining an inclusive, engaged team environment
  • Report on individual and team-level performance to senior leadership, identifying strengths and opportunities for improvement
  • Maintain daily activity goals and weekly, monthly, quarterly reporting for various business stakeholders; drive adherence to SDR Playbook and enforce rules of engagement
  • Partner with marketing to improve lead scoring and SDR/demand generation processes by providing regular, actionable feedback
  • Partner with sales training to improve team prospecting skills, objection handling and product knowledge; establish individual and team-level training cadences to improve effectiveness
  • Partner with Sales to improve AE:SDR partnership and prospecting plans

Requirements
  • 1+ years SDR management experience with a consistent record of quota attainment
  • 1+ years of quota-carrying sales experience (ie. SDR or full-cycle)
  • Strong expertise in outbound sales, primarily through email, phone, and social selling
  • You have full ability to operate at all levels, and you love to get in the trenches with your team, do cold calling and write email copy
  • You are an expert at partnering with marketing and your AE counterparts to plan and execute multi-touch, multi-channel campaigns
  • Expert at using LinkedIn, Outreach, SalesNav, ZoomInfo, SFDC

CompensationThe expected OTE range for this role is CA$120,000 - $150,000. The starting wage will depend on a number of factors including the candidate's location, skills, experience, market demands, and internal pay parity. The OTE figure listed here includes base salary and commissions, which may or may not be earned depending on performance. Depending on the position offered, equity and other forms of compensation may be provided as part of a total compensation package.

About Brex Inc

Brex is a financial services company that offers credit cards and cash management accounts to technology companies. Brex was founded in 2017 by Henrique Dubugras and Pedro Franceschi. The company is headquartered in San Francisco, California. Brex offers a credit card designed specifically for startups, which does not require a personal guarantee or deposit. The company also offers a cash management account that allows businesses to manage their finances in one place. Brex has raised over $300 million in funding from investors including Y Combinator, Peter Thiel, and Max Levchin.
